Coding is an important aspect of the technology landscape. All disciplines are currently emphasizing the significance of expertise in computer programming. Coding has been introduced as a boon to our learners as a result of their discovery of the reality of the situation. In today’s digital age, everything from cell phones to high-end televisions and automobiles runs on programmed code.
According to Reader’s Digest, over half of all jobs paying at least 7,00,000INR, per annum, require some coding knowledge. Coding proficiency is perhaps the most sought-after employment skill, and learning to code is helpful for a variety of jobs in a wide range of industries.
Define your goal.
When organising contests, the first question to ask is “why?” Why do you wish to hold a codathon? Is it to boost your company’s innovative capabilities? Is it to bring attention to a social problem? Or to broaden your field of possible hires? The answer to the question “why?” will have an impact on everything else.
A well-organized squad is required for a codathon to be successful. When we begin organising a competition, one individual generally offers to serve as the competition coordinator. Their role is to coordinate activities in order for the competition to be a success.
First, the organiser must put together a team. They enlist the aid of others to write issues and manage the tournament. Posting a message in the community has shown to be the most successful means to get better interest. This request for assistance immediately generates a group of interested individuals who may meet to discuss the event and venue. Sometimes one person sets up the location, while another person handles the coding portion of the codathon competition. Your team can create, write, and proofread problem-solving ideas. With multiple team members in charge of different aspects of the competition, no one individual is left to perform all the work.
You can compete in any programming language, although C/C++, Java, and Python are strongly encouraged. Discover all the syntaxes, built-in methods, frameworks, excerpts, and library operations available, such as STL in C++ and Big Integers in Java. Working with the basics will assist everyone in the long run. Sometimes a codathon can be language agnostic as well
The rules are critical for both generating difficulties and conducting the tournament. Make sure the participants understand what is and isn’t permitted. Here are some things to think about:
Is it a one-on-one competition, or will individuals work in groups?
How many PCs are available to each team?
What, if any, internet resources are permitted? What about language documentation?
How do problem statements get graded? Is it possible to earn points for partial answers that pass parts of the test cases, or is it all or nothing? Are the issues timed? Do incorrect submissions increase a participant’s overall time?
You will be tasked with resolving a variety of issues. It is advised that you execute your codathon conducting organization to enhance the efficiency and speed of your operation. Yaksha is one of the prominent customizable codathon/hackathon organizers where you may practise and assess your employee’s skills and enjoy their unique features of customised problem statements that can result in effective solutions. You may now concentrate on addressing the real logic of the issues.
Leaderboards create a sense of urge and competitive spirit among the participants. Leaderboard stage to connect every one of the participants and compare their performances. Real-time rankings would highly develop a team spirit and a sportive intent and spin to the competition.
Finally, once you plan and set up all the steps, it’s time for you to act upon your end goals of codathon. Found the best solution to the problem? Time to recognize them! Codathons for employees drive better employee engagement when you reward and recognize the problem-solvers. Or if your goal was hiring, codathons will also help you match their skills (both coding and problem-solving) to the job roles in the organization.
There is no point in having a square peg in a round
Hiring help for the HR team from the Techie team When it
Every company, big or small, seeks business growth and development. Companies that
Multi-file assessment is a powerful tool in assessing someone’s core technical skills. It can be